// Constants: W as an array of f64 values
const W = [
0.40255, 1.18385, 3.173, 15.69105, 7.1949, 0.5345, 1.4604, 0.0046, 1.54575, 0.1192,
1.01925, 1.9395, 0.11, 0.29605, 2.2698, 0.2315, 2.9898, 0.51655, 0.6621
];
// Grade enum representation
const Grade = {
Forgot: 1.0,
Hard: 2.0,
Good: 3.0,
Easy: 4.0
};
// Helper to convert Grade to f64 (as in From<Grade> for f64)
function gradeToNumber(g) {
return Grade[g];
}
// Constants
const F = 19.0 / 81.0;
const C = -0.5;
// retrievability(t: T, s: S) -> R
function retrievability(t, s) {
return Math.pow(1.0 + F * (t / s), C);
}
// interval(r_d: R, s: S) -> T
function interval(rD, s) {
return (s / F) * (Math.pow(rD, 1.0 / C) - 1.0);
}
// s_0(g: Grade) -> S
function s0(g) {
switch (g) {
case Grade.Forgot: return W[0];
case Grade.Hard: return W[1];
case Grade.Good: return W[2];
case Grade.Easy: return W[3];
default: throw new Error("Invalid grade");
}
}
// s_success(d: D, s: S, r: R, g: Grade) -> S
function sSuccess(d, s, r, g) {
const tD = 11.0 - d;
const tS = Math.pow(s, -W[9]);
const tR = Math.exp(W[10] * (1.0 - r)) - 1.0;
const h = (g === Grade.Hard) ? W[15] : 1.0;
const b = (g === Grade.Easy) ? W[16] : 1.0;
const c = Math.exp(W[8]);
const alpha = 1.0 + tD * tS * tR * h * b * c;
return s * alpha;
}
